Catherine: no, I'm talking about the obscure, early 80s post-punk band from Sheffield. I discovered them recently and I like some of their stuff. Their better songs have kind of a Joy Division meets Teardrop Explodes vibe. Horrid name, though. Would be better much suited to a Norwegian death-metal band. |

It was, certainly a landmark in a number of ways. Sharp and honest politically (the record trade, the ganja trade and the police department are all in each other's back pocket) and darker overall than I thought it would be. The DVD I'm watching has an excellent commentary by Cliff and writer/director Perry Henzell. |

I would'nt mind if "Change Your Mind" were even longer, actually...to me SWA is an album like "A Thousand Leaves" - it feels endless, in the best possible way, nearly every song opening out into eternity (which is why, when I make my top 10 Neil list, "Weld" is going to be on it). To me the only slightly weak link is the title track: like many tributes to dead peers, especially ones who've gone recently, it feels overly self-conscious, like he's trying to cover too many bases at once while remaining unpretentious. |
